Bideford is a historic seaside town in North Devon, situated on the River Torridge. This vibrant town has a diverse range of businesses, cafés and restaurants, a park, and the Atlantic Village Outlet Shopping Centre on the outskirts. Ideally situated for exploring the surrounding area, Bideford is only a few minutes from Westward Ho!, which boasts two miles of breathtaking shoreline and proudly displays the famous Blue Flag distinction year after year.

  • Nikki

    The house itself is beautiful, noisy floor boards but a lovely house, spacious and clean and the kids loved the hot tub! We paid £2.5k for the 4 days, and for this amount of money unfortunately there was quite a few let downs. There was a serious lack of any personal touches for the stay. I’ve stayed at many home rentals and always been greeted with fresh milk, enough bin bags, cleaning equipment, salt and pepper, toilet rolls, travel toiletries etc. there was none of this, so when we arrived we had to go shopping for basic things. When we booked for a Christmas stay we asked that because we have 3 children coming could they confirm there would be a Christmas tree which we was told absolutely yes…well I’ve honestly never seen such a sad £10 Tesco tree ever, zero effort with that, really disappointing ! The kitchen window didn’t open, so cooking meals for a family of 8 was not a nice experience. Downstairs smelt damp and felt damp especially in the two single rooms joined by sliding doors, my son has asthma so we had to move rooms around after the first night because he was coughing all night. Upstairs stayed lovely and warm but downstairs was so cold, with all the bedrooms downstairs it wasn’t ideal. No extra linen for the beds. The fire alarm went off 4 times for no reason. Check out is 9am! Be warned of the sharp bend leading up to the property. We had a lovely Christmas, but unfortunately any effort from the owner was no where to be seen. You’re literally just staying in an empty house, so you’d need to pack and shop for all the basics before you arrive.
